Crows Toes Alfheim swatches - 9 Realms collection 2014

Crows Toes Alfheim is from the 9 Realms collection 2014.
Alfheim is a very pale and slightly silvery green holo.
I was a bit disappointed at first and thought to myself, ah well, a work safe palate cleanser, but then I went out in the sun – and holy moly – the rainbows queued to dazzle me!! The holo is also really visible in indoor light and strong in artificial light. This is two easy coats with a coat of Seche Vite.
